Key aspects to understand the heraldry availability of the surname Do prado

Exclusivity and legality in heraldry: blazon and coat of arms of Do prado

Traditionally, the coat of arms is granted specifically to an individual with the surname Do prado, without this right extending to all those who share the same surname. The possibility of using a particular coat of arms is governed by heraldic laws and traditions, which implies that not all those who bear the surname Do prado possess the heraldic right to use the coat of arms associated with their ancestors.

Emblematic connection of the blazoning with the surname Do prado

The link between the blazoning and Do prado is deep and enigmatic. Initially, coats of arms were awarded to individual people, not to an entire lineage, and were related to the individual who had acquired them for their exploits, battles or social status. As time passed, the Do prado crest became hereditary, becoming a recognizable emblem of the family, thus establishing an enduring connection with the surname Do prado.

Essential points about the connection between the coat of arms and the surname Do prado

Legacy: Although the heraldic emblem could be associated with Do prado, it is essential to keep in mind that they were traditionally granted to individuals. This implies that not all individuals with the surname Do prado have hereditary right to the shield corresponding to Do prado, especially if they cannot prove a direct lineage with the original holder of the shield. Likewise, it is possible that we find various shields for the surname Do prado, since they could have been granted to individuals from different families but with the surname Do prado.
